About agriculture in Sedinginan

Sedinginan is located in the Riau province of Indonesia, nestled within a landscape characterized by lush tropical lowlands and dense riverine networks. The area is surrounded by expansive equatorial forests and is situated relatively close to major waterways, which play a vital role in local logistics and environmental conditions.

Agricultural production in this region is dominated by large-scale commodity plantations, primarily palm oil, which define much of the local rural economy. Beyond palm oil, smallholder farms also engage in diverse tropical crop cultivation, often utilizing the fertile, albeit humid, soil conditions to grow staples and various fruit varieties suited to the equatorial climate.
